Transaction 573896e9f2b0a66cdd3052fcc538715b0dda6d4d887b28a4598d74efa135c42e

2 Input
2 Outputs
  • 573896e9f2b0a66cdd3052fcc538715b0dda6d4d887b28a4598d74efa135c42e:0
  • value  1000912
    address  2NCbJVmMJ7evNhki4jg8ZRBRgfKoN4sTZf4
  • 573896e9f2b0a66cdd3052fcc538715b0dda6d4d887b28a4598d74efa135c42e:1
  • value  43379
    address  2MupnUdGdgjG4mr3Zraoy2nEjd3nEvis9rZ